Victorian Injury Surveillance Unit (VISU) Data Request Service
The Victorian Injury Surveillance Unit is based at MUARC and has been analysing, interpreting and disseminating data on injury deaths, hospital admissions and emergency department presentations across the state, nationally and internationally for more than 30 years. Requests for information can be lodged via the data request form on the VISU website.
